3.3KW OBC + 1.5KW DC/DC Integrated 2-in-1 OBC for EV Systems
The 3.3KW OBC + 1.5KW DC/DC 2-in-1 integrated controller is a compact, high-efficiency power solution designed specifically for electric vehicle. By combining the On-Board Charger and DC/DC converter into a single unit, it significantly reduces vehicle weight, optimizes installation space, and simplifies wiring architecture while maintaining automotive-grade reliability.
Key Features
- Dual-Function Integration: Seamlessly combines a 3.3KW charger and a 1.5KW converter to power both high-voltage battery charging and low-voltage auxiliary systems.
- High Efficiency & Power Factor: Features ≥93% charging efficiency and a power factor >0.98, ensuring minimal energy loss and stable grid connection.
- IP67 Rugged Protection: Both the main body and the cooling fan meet IP67 standards, providing complete protection against dust and water immersion.
- Advanced Safety Suite: Hardware-level protection against over/under voltage, short circuits, reverse polarity, and over-temperature.
- Smart Communication: Features Molex connectors for CAN_H/CAN_L communication, supporting real-time status monitoring and BMS integration.

Applications
- Light Electric Vehicles (LEVs) & Neighborhood Electric Vehicles (NEVs).
- Electric Golf Carts & Utility Patrol Cars.
- Electric Forklifts & Small Specialized Engineering Vehicles.
